Ilaló lodge is located in the Village of La Merced (2,700 m - 8,900 ft) on the base of the Ilaló Volcano (peak 3,200 m or 10,500 ft) that is famous for its special energy. It is home to Ruben and Stacey and surrounded by several kilometers of walking, biking and birding trails. La Merced Village, offers among other things, food markets, hot springs, small family restaurants, and traditional cultural celebrations during Carnival, Holy Week, Christmas, New Years, Village days and it’s Patron Saints Day. Ilaló Lodge makes for a wonderful home base to explore other incredible sites such as the capital city, Quito, volcanos Pichincha, Pasachoa, Ruminahui, Sincholagua, and the Ilinizas. In addition, there are the famous glaciered covered volcanos, Antisana, Cotopaxi, and Cayambe. Of course many, many other sites as well. During this time of Covid19 access to public transportation is uncertain. However, under normal conditions, access to public transportation is very easy. The Ilaló Lodge is an 8 minute walk to the bus stop and there are taxi trucks available throughout the Village of La Merced. The bus service from La Merced to the capital city of Quito (La Marin - main terminal in Quito) takes about an hour and currently costs .40 cents. We are approximately 35 km (20 miles) from the airport which takes about 40 minutes to get to and currently costs $25 in taxi. (There is presently no convenient bus service to and from the airport.)
